为了账号安全,请及时绑定邮箱和手机立即绑定

python正则表达式

难度初级
时长 1小时29分
学习人数
综合评分9.40
211人评价 查看评价
9.7 内容实用
9.4 简洁易懂
9.1 逻辑清晰

最新回答 / 慕粉2305276753
linux服务器上安装ipython,如果有安装pip的话直接用pip安装就行了,安装完成之后用命令ipython就可以使用了

最赞回答 / 无酒不欢滴酒必醉
可以试试urllib.request.urlopen

最赞回答 / 小叶柏杉
[0-9][a-z]*? 匹配2个 因为[0-9]要匹配一个,[a-z]*?最少匹配0个,所以[0-9][a-z]*?就是1个元素+?最少匹配一个  [0-9][a-z]+? 就是2个元素( 上面那个打错了 )

最赞回答 / 慕慕4196146
首先,^放在[...]里边才会表示反义,例如[^a]表示匹配除了a以外的字符,如果^放在[]外面,则表示以[...]字符为开头还有在[...]中不需要使用“|”表示或的关系,[...]中的“|”被认为需要匹配“|”这个字符

最新回答 / 阿井
这个是match的特性,如果将match换成findall就可以匹配出全部符合的对象的了,相类似的还有search等。

最新回答 / 卡立托
反回类型是字符串,grour()里不传参数,默认传的是组0,即整个正则表达式字符串。如果传入多个组,match.group([group1,...]),则返回的是元组。

最新回答 / Giroy3925940
line.startswith是匹配字符串开头你换成line.endswith试试

最新回答 / qq_1_95
我也是新手哈,给我感觉:此处有 2 层“[”和“]”,其中一层是原生字符,一层是匹配字符,转义的作用就是为了区分这两者吧

最新回答 / 孤独的小猪
* 可以匹配 1 次,*代表的是匹配前一个字符零次或者无限次。<...图片...>

最新回答 / 孤独的小猪
安装python的时候,安装一下pip,然后用pip安装iptyhon就行了。如下:<...code...><...图片...>

最赞回答 / 慕斯5482594
<...code...>HTTP是基于请求和应答机制的--客户端提出请求,服务端提供应答。urllib2用一个Request对象来映射你提出的HTTP请求,在它最简单的使用形式中你将用你要请求的地址创建一个Request对象,...
课程须知
本课程是Python中级课程 1、本课程在linux讲解,最好有linux开发环境 1、熟练掌握Python开发语言基础语法
老师告诉你能学到什么?
1.正则表达式基本语法 2.使用re模块处理文本

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消